
Среди сторонних прошивок для Android LineageOS является одной из самых популярных. Спустя несколько месяцев после официального выпуска Android 13 для телефонов Pixel, LineageOS 20, основанная на новейшей мобильной ОС, готова.
Объявленная в длинном посте в блоге команды Lineage, LineageOS 20 разрабатывалась с октября 2022 года, но теперь готова для большого числа устройств. Поскольку большая часть работы уже проделана, а требования к «приведению в рабочее состояние» для Android 13 просты, этот процесс был легче для команды Lineage.
Эта сборка включает существенное обновление стандартного приложения камеры, входящего в состав LineageOS 20. Переименованное в «Aperture», оно было написано разработчиками SebaUbuntu, LuK1337 и luca020400, с внешним видом, более близким к приложению Google Camera, которое установлено на телефонах Pixel. Оно использует API CameraX, с еще более точными опциями для камеры вашего устройства, включая управление частотой кадров видео, полные настройки EIS и OIS, плюс функцию ориентации изображения, работающую как уровень Gcam.

Новое приложение камеры — лишь верхушка айсберга, поскольку эта прошивка включает множество других изменений, с которыми вы можете ознакомиться в списке изменений ниже. Стоит также отметить, что все исправления безопасности с апреля 2022 года по декабрь 2022 года были объединены в LineageOS 17.1 и вплоть до LineageOS 20.
Полный список изменений LineageOS 20
- Исправления безопасности с апреля 2022 года по декабрь 2022 года объединены в LineageOS 17.1 — 20.
ohmagoditfinallyhappened
— в LineageOS теперь есть потрясающее новое приложение камеры под названием Aperture! Оно основано на (в основном) потрясающей библиотеке Google CameraX и обеспечивает гораздо более близкий к «стоковому» интерфейс камеры на многих устройствах. Огромная благодарность разработчикам SebaUbuntu, LuK1337 и luca020400, которые изначально разработали его, дизайнеру Vazguard, и всей команде за работу по интеграции его в LineageOS и адаптации к нашему огромному парку поддерживаемых устройств!- WebView обновлен до Chromium 108.0.5359.79.
- Мы представили полностью переработанную панель громкости в Android 13 и продолжили развивать нашу боковую выдвижную панель.
- Теперь мы поддерживаем сборки GKI и Linux 5.10 с полной поддержкой внешних модулей в соответствии с новыми соглашениями AOSP.
- В нашем форке приложения AOSP Gallery внесено множество исправлений и улучшений.
- В нашем приложении Updater внесено множество исправлений ошибок и улучшений, а также теперь у него новый красивый макет для Android TV!
- В нашем веб-браузере Jelly внесено несколько исправлений ошибок и улучшений!
- Мы внесли еще больше изменений и улучшений в календарное приложение FOSS Etar, которое мы интегрировали некоторое время назад!
- Мы внесли еще больше изменений и улучшений в приложение для резервного копирования Seedvault.
- Наше приложение Recorder было адаптировано для учета встроенных функций Android, при этом сохранив функции, которые вы ожидаете от LineageOS.
- Приложение было значительно переработано.
- Добавлена поддержка Material You.
- Высококачественный рекордер (формат WAV) теперь поддерживает стерео, и внесено несколько исправлений многопоточности.
- Сборки Android TV теперь поставляются с лаунчером Android TV без рекламы, в отличие от лаунчера Google с рекламой — мы также поддерживаем сборки в стиле Google TV и рассматриваем возможность их внедрения на поддерживаемые устройства в будущем.
- Множество функций Google TV, таких как гораздо более привлекательное двухпанельное приложение настроек, были портированы на сборки LineageOS Android TV.
- Наш сервис
adb_root
больше не привязан к свойству типа сборки, что обеспечивает лучшую совместимость со многими сторонними системами root.- Наши скрипты слияния были значительно переработаны, что значительно упростило процесс слияния Android Security Bulletin, а также сделало поддержку устройств, таких как Pixel, с полными релизами исходного кода, намного более упорядоченной.
- LLVM был полностью принят, и сборки теперь по умолчанию используют bin-utils LLVM и, опционально, встроенный ассемблер LLVM. Для тех, у кого старые ядра, не беспокойтесь, вы всегда можете отказаться.
- Был разработан глобальный режим подсветки Quick Settings, чтобы этот элемент пользовательского интерфейса соответствовал теме устройства.
- Наш мастер настройки был адаптирован для Android 13, с новым стилем и более плавными переходами/улучшенным пользовательским опытом.
В настоящее время список сборки еще не включает устройства Pixel на базе Tensor. Однако, начиная с Pixel 4a и до Pixel 5a, можно установить LineageOS 20 и использовать более гибкую сборку Android 13. Более 30 устройств теперь могут быть обновлены, полный список приведен ниже:
- ASUS ZenFone 5Z (Z01R)
- Fairphone 4 (FP4)
- F(x)tec Pro (pro1)
- Pixel 4a (sunfish)
- Pixel 4a 5G (bramble)
- Pixel 4 (flame)
- Pixel 4 XL (coral)
- Pixel 5 (redfin)
- Pixel 5a (barbet)
- Lenovo Z5 Pro GT (heart)
- Lenovo Z6 pro (zippo)
- Motorola edge (racer)
- Motorola edge 20 (berlin)
- Motorola edge 30 (dubai)
- Motorola Moto edge s / moto g100 (nio)
- Motorola moto g 5G / one 5G ace (kiev)
- Motorola moto g 5G plus / one 5G (nairo)
- Motorola moto g6 plus (evert)
- Motorola moto g7 play (channel)
- Motorola moto g7 power (ocean)
- Motorola moto g7 (river)
- Motorola moto g7 plus (lake)
- Motorola moto x4 (payton)
- Motorola moto z3 play (beckham)
- Motorola one power (chef)
- Nubia Mini 5G (TP1803)
- OnePlus 5 (cheeseburger)
- OnePlus 5T (dumpling)
- OnePlus 6 (enchilada)
- OnePlus 6T (fajita)
- OnePlus 7 (guacamoleb)
- OnePlus 7 Pro (guacamole)
- OnePlus 7T (hotdogb)
- OnePlus 7T Pro (hotdog)
- OnePlus 8 (instantnoodle)
- OnePlus 8 Pro (instantnoodlep)
- OnePlus 8T (kebab)
- OnePlus 9 (lemonade)
- OnePlus 9 Pro (lemonadep)
- Razer Phone 2 (aura)
- Samsung Galaxy Tab S5e (LTE) (gts4lv)
- Samsung Galaxy Tab S5e (Wi-Fi) (gts4lvwifi)
- Sony Xperia 1 II (pdx203)
- Xiaomi Mi 8 (dipper)
- Xiaomi Mi 8 Explorer Edition (ursa)
- Xiaomi Mi 8 Pro (equuleus)
- Xiaomi Mi 8 SE (xmsirius)
- Xiaomi Mi 9 SE (grus)
- Xiaomi Mi CC / mi 9 Lite (pyxis)
- Xiaomi Mi MIX 2S (polaris)
- Xiaomi Poco F1 (beryllium)
Для поддержки LineageOS 20, версия 18.1 теперь находится на «заморозке функций». Заявки на устройства будут по-прежнему приниматься, но основной упор будет сделан на сборки Android 12 и Android 13.
Подробнее о LineageOS:
- Raspberry Pi уже может работать под управлением Android TV 13 — Chromecast получил Android 12 всего несколько недель назад
- Pixel 7 и 7 Pro получили первую «официальную» поддержку кастомных прошивок благодаря Paranoid Android
- Поддержка LineageOS 19 добавлена для устройства Google ADT-3 и Moto Edge 20